Introduction

BIOLOGICAL & PHARMACEUTICAL BULLETIN, published by the PHARMACEUTICAL SOC JAPAN, is a prominent peer-reviewed journal that serves the fields of medicine, pharmaceutical science, and pharmacology. With an ISSN of 0918-6158 and an E-ISSN of 1347-5215, this publication has been crucial in disseminating innovative research since its inception in 1993, and it continues to contribute significantly to the body of knowledge as it converges towards 2024. Despite being classified as a non-open access journal, it maintains a respectable Q3 ranking in Medicine (miscellaneous) and Q2 in Pharmaceutical Science, highlighting its critical role in advancing scientific discourse in these areas. With Scopus rankings placing it in the 51st percentile for Pharmaceutical Science and 38th percentile for Pharmacology, BIOLOGICAL & PHARMACEUTICAL BULLETIN is an essential resource for researchers, professionals, and students looking to stay abreast of cutting-edge developments and trends in biomedicine and drug development.
